Drug Prograf is what? Indications of the drug Tacrolimus
Prograf indications: Prevention of organ transplant rejection in patients with allogeneic kidney or liver transplant. Should be combined with adrenal corticosteroids. Due to the risk of hypersensitivity, Prograf is injected only when it cannot be administered orally.
The drug Prograf (tacrolimus) lowers the body's immune system. The immune system helps the body fight off infections. The immune system can also fight or "eliminate" a transplanted organ such as a liver or kidney. This is because the immune system treats the new organ as an invader.
Medications are used together with other drugs to prevent your body from refusing a heart , liver, or kidney transplant . The drug may also be used for purposes not listed in this medication guide.
Important information about the drug Prograf
Caution: Diabetes mellitus after insulin-dependent transplantation. Nerve and kidney toxicity. Should monitor blood potassium concentration, do not use potassium-sparing diuretics. Increased risk of developing lymphomas and other malignancies, especially of the skin. Hypertension is a common side effect. Patients with renal impairment. Pregnancy, lactation. When driving and operating the machine.
Prograf may increase your risk of serious infections, lymphoma, or other types of cancer. Talk with your doctor about the risks and benefits of using this medicine.
You will need periodic medical tests to make sure the medicine is not causing harmful effects. Don't miss any follow-up doctor visits to test blood or urine. Avoid people who are sick or have infections.
Call your doctor at once if you have any signs of infection, such as fever, chills, body aches, hot skin or red eyes, or flu symptoms.
Call your doctor at once if you have symptoms of a serious brain infection, such as changes in mental state, problems with speaking or walking, or decreased vision. These symptoms can start gradually and get worse.
Prograf can harm your kidneys, and this effect will increase when you use certain other medicines that are harmful to the kidneys. Before use tell your doctor about all other medicines you use. Many other drugs (including some over-the-counter medicines) can harm the kidneys.
Note before taking Prograf 1mg
Contraindications: Use on an empty stomach, at least 1 hour before eating or 2-3 hours after eating. Avoid using with grapefruit juice.
You should not use Prograf if you are allergic to tacrolimus or hydrogenated castor oil, or if you have used cyclosporine (Neoral, Sandimmune, Gengraf) within the past 24 hours.
Medications may increase your risk of serious infections, lymphomas, or other types of cancer. Talk with your doctor about the risks and benefits of using this medicine.
Prograf use may also increase your risk of developing skin cancer, especially if you are treated for a long time with drugs that weaken the immune system. Talk to your doctor about your specific risk.
Some people taking Prograf after a kidney transplant have had diabetes. This effect has been seen most commonly among Hispanics or African-Americans. Talk to your doctor about your personal diabetes risk if you have concerns.
To make sure this medicine is safe for you, tell your doctor if you:
kidney or liver disease;
heart disease, high blood pressure, high cholesterol or triglycerides (a type of fat in the blood);
a heart rhythm disturbance or a history of long QT syndrome;
if you take heart rhythm medicine; or
If you use other drugs that can weaken your immune system.
Do not know if the drug will harm an unborn baby. Tell your doctor if you are pregnant or plan to become pregnant while using this medicine.
Tacrolimus can pass into breast milk and may harm a nursing baby. You should not breast-feed while using the drug.

Dosage and how to use Prograf?
Amount:
Prograf for injection: dilute with 0.9% NaCl or 5% dextrose to a concentration of 0.004 mg / ml and 0.02 mg / ml before use; The first dose should be administered within the first 6 hours after transplantation, 0.03-0.05mg / kg / day intravenous infusion, with corticosteroids, continue infusion until the patient can take pills.
Prograf tablets: adult kidney transplant: starting 0.2 mg / kg / day, adult liver transplant: starting 0.10-0.15 mg / kg / day, pediatric liver transplant: 0.15-0.20 mg / kg / day, the dose is split every 12 hours. Blood concentration monitoring: monitoring of tacrolimus in the blood in combination with other clinical parameters is considered as the primary tool for patient management to evaluate transplant rejection, toxicity, and dose adjustment and compatibility.
Usage: Use on an empty stomach, at least 1 hour before eating or 2-3 hours after eating. Avoid using with grapefruit juice.
Take your medicine exactly as directed by your doctor. Follow all directions on your prescription label. Your doctor may sometimes change your dose to make sure you get the best results. Do not take this medicine in larger or smaller amounts or for longer than recommended.
You can inject Prograf right after your transplant. The injection will be given until you are ready to take the tablet form of tacrolimus.
Bring your medicine at the same time every day. Capsules are usually taken every 12 hours.
You can take the medicine with or without food, but take it the same way each time.
If your doctor changes the brand, strength, or type of tacrolimus, your dosage needs may change. Ask your pharmacist if you have questions about the new type of tacrolimus you get at the pharmacy.
While using Prograf, you may need frequent blood tests. Your blood pressure will need to be checked often.
Store at room temperature away from moisture and heat.
What happens if I miss a dose?
Take the missed dose as soon as you remember. Skip the missed dose if it is almost time for your next dose. Do not take extra medicine to make up the missed dose.

What should i avoid while taking Prograf?
Do not receive a “live” vaccine while taking the medicine, or you could develop a serious infection. Live vaccines include measles, mumps, rubella (MMR), rotavirus, typhoid, yellow fever, chickenpox (varicella), zoster (shingles), and swine (flu) vaccine.
Grapefruit and grapefruit juice can interact with tacrolimus and lead to undesirable side effects. Avoid using grapefruit products while taking the medication.
Avoid drinking alcohol. It can increase your risk of side effects.
Avoid people who are sick or have infections. Tell your doctor right away if you develop signs of infection.
Avoid exposure to sunlight or tanning beds. Prograf can make you sunburn more easily. Wear protective clothing and use sunscreen (SPF 30 or higher) when you are outdoors.

Side effects Prograf
Get emergency medical help if you have signs of an allergic reaction : hives; shortness of breath; sw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at.
A serious and sometimes fatal infection can occur during treatment with Prograf. Stop using this medicine and call your doctor at once if you have signs of infection such as: sudden weakness or feeling sick, fever, chills, sweating, sore throat, sore mouth, mouth sores, skin ulcers, redness, flu symptoms, muscle aches, pale skin cough, easy bruising or unusual bleeding.
Also call your doctor at once if you:
general pain, pain, or swelling near the transplanted organ;
changes in mental state, problems with speaking or walking, decreased vision (may begin gradually and faster);
little or no urinating; pain in the urine or difficulty urinating; swelling in the feet or ankles;
headache with chest pain and dizziness, fainting, fast or pounding heartbeat;
high blood pressure - severe headache, blurred vision, pain in your neck, ears, anxiety;
high blood sugar - increased thirst, increased urination, hunger, fruity stench, nausea, loss of appetite, drowsiness, blurred vision, confusion;
low magnesium or phosphate-bone pain, jerky muscle movement, muscle weakness or indecency, slow reflexes;
nerve problems - confusion, headache, problems with vision, tremor, numbness and a feeling of itching, convulsions (convulsions); or
signs of stomach bleeding - bloody or delayed stools, coughing up blood or vomiting that looks like coffee grounds.
Common Prograf side effects may include:
infections, high blood pressure, low phosphate, high potassium;
kidney problems, urination problems;
tremor or shaking, numbness or itching;
nausea, diarrhea, constipation, stomach pain;
weakness, headache, general pain;
sleep problems (insomnia); or
swelling in your hands and feet.
What other drugs will affect Prograf?
Medications can harm your kidneys. This effect increases when you use a number of other drugs, including: antivirals, chemistry, injectable antibiotics, medicine for bowel disorders, injectable osteoporosis drugs, and some pain or inflammation medications. joints (including aspirin, Tylenol, Advil, and Aleve).
Many drugs can interact with tacrolimus and should not be used at the same time. This includes prescription and over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al products. Not all possible drug interactions are listed in this medication guide. Tell each of your health care providers about all medicines you use now and any medicine you start or stop using. Tell your doctor about all your current medicines and any you start or stop using during your treatment with Prograf, especially:
amiodarone;
cyclosporine;
nelfinavir;
sirolimus; or
hepatitis C medicines boceprevir or telaprevir.
Drug Interactions: Use with caution with other drugs with nephrotoxicity, immunodeficiency drugs, drugs metabolized by the CYP3A enzyme system. Not recommended for use with cyclosporine. Immunization.
